Transaction 63b5aafc56e44e90b950c83ee9088b655f6808e4e580c8d7d5eb4d8c56d6e373

1 Input
2 Outputs
  • 63b5aafc56e44e90b950c83ee9088b655f6808e4e580c8d7d5eb4d8c56d6e373:0
  • value  1872410
    address  18kXC2wSApgujMEFnGwU2aghNJkGqUAXrw
  • 63b5aafc56e44e90b950c83ee9088b655f6808e4e580c8d7d5eb4d8c56d6e373:1
  • value  510271487
    address  3KYyWfAVnWRgLvvvRrhatxdmE8xBHSevVb